7:00 p.m.- 8:00 p.m. The Call to Formative Instruction- Deuteronomy 6

Formative instruction provides children with biblical ways of thinking. It is the process of instruction that enables our children to root all of life in God's revelation in the Bible.  Formative instruction is not focused on correcting something that has gone wrong; it focus is providing ways of interpreting and responding to life that are biblical.

8:15 p.m.- 9:15 p.m. Giving Children a Vision for the Glory of God - Psalm 145

Children are instinctively worshipers.  They are made in the image of God and are hard-wired for worship.  They love to be awed.  They delight in marveling at things.  They will either worship God the Creator or created things.  We will identify some common idols of the heart as well as our calling as parents is to hold the glory and goodness of God before our children.

9:00 a.m. - 10:00 a.m. Giving Children an Understanding of Authority - Ephesians 6

Our culture thinks of authority as derived from overwhelming force or consent.  We have no idea that it is good and proper for some to be in authority and for others to be under authority. Parents often, unwittingly make their children independent decision makers.  When we do, we give them an appetite for a liberty that does not exist and a mistaken notion about freedom. True freedom is living joyfully under the authorities that God has ordained.

10:10 a.m.- 11:10 a.m. Giving Children an Understanding of the Heart- Proverbs 4:23

Proverbs 4 says "the heart is the well-spring of life."  Luke 6 says that it is "out of the overflow of the heart that the mouth speaks."  If behavior flows from the heart, then we cannot think about behavior biblically without reference to the heart.  This teaching will equip us to help our children see how behavior that has strayed reflects a heart that has strayed.

Corrective Discipline - Spanking, Sowing & Reaping, & Communication

The Proverbs makes a clear case for spanking, especially as we deal with small children.  This teaching will provide clear guideline for physical discipline that is gracious and kind.  The second part of this session will explore the sowing and reaping principle of the Bible and root our administration of consequences for our children in rich biblical soil.  Additionally, we will examine some of the biblical principles that can guide our communication.  The seminar will end with the reminder that the grace and strength, insight and wisdom for this work is found in Christ.
